LYWSD03MMC to Vera quick hack

#!/usr/bin/python3 | |
from bluepy import btle | |
import argparse | |
import os | |
import re | |
import requests | |
import time | |
veraip = "192.168.1.39" | |
port = 3480 | |
temperaturedeviceid = 769 | |
humiditydeviceid = 772 | |
class MyDelegate(btle.DefaultDelegate): | |
def __init__(self, params): | |
btle.DefaultDelegate.__init__(self) | |
# ... initialise here | |
def handleNotification(self, cHandle, data): | |
try: | |
temp=int.from_bytes(data[0:2],byteorder='little')/100 | |
if args.round: | |
#print("Temperatur unrounded: " + str(temp)) | |
temp=round(temp,1) | |
humidity=int.from_bytes(data[2:3],byteorder='little') | |
print("Temperature: " + str(temp)) | |
print("Humidity: " + str(humidity)) | |
res = requests.get("http://"+veraip+":"+str(port)+"/data_request?id=variableset&DeviceNum="+str(temperaturedeviceid)+"&serviceId=urn:upnp-org:serviceId:TemperatureSensor1&Variable=CurrentTemperature&Value="+str(temp)) | |
res = requests.get("http://"+veraip+":"+str(port)+"/data_request?id=variableset&DeviceNum="+str(temperaturedeviceid)+"&serviceId=urn:micasaverde-com:serviceId:HaDevice1&Variable=LastUpdate&Value="+str(int(time.time()))) | |
res = requests.get("http://"+veraip+":"+str(port)+"/data_request?id=variableset&DeviceNum="+str(humiditydeviceid)+"&serviceId=urn:micasaverde-com:serviceId:HumiditySensor1&Variable=CurrentLevel&Value="+str(humidity)) | |
res = requests.get("http://"+veraip+":"+str(port)+"/data_request?id=variableset&DeviceNum="+str(humiditydeviceid)+"&serviceId=urn:micasaverde-com:serviceId:HaDevice1&Variable=LastUpdate&Value="+str(int(time.time()))) | |
if args.offset: | |
humidityCalibrated = humidity + args.offset | |
print("Calibrated humidity: " + str(humidityCalibrated)) | |
if args.TwoPointCalibration: | |
offset1=args.offset1 | |
offset2=args.offset2 | |
p1y=args.calpoint1 | |
p2y=args.calpoint2 | |
p1x=p1y - offset1 | |
p2x=p2y - offset2 | |
m = (p1y - p2y) * 1.0 / (p1x - p2x) # y=mx+b | |
#b = (p1x * p2y - p2x * p1y) * 1.0 / (p1y - p2y) | |
b = p2y - m * p2x #would be more efficient to do this calculations only once | |
humidityCalibrated=m*humidity + b | |
if (humidityCalibrated > 100 ): #with correct calibration this should not happen | |
humidityCalibrated = 100 | |
elif (humidityCalibrated < 0): | |
humidityCalibrated = 0 | |
humidityCalibrated=int(round(humidityCalibrated,0)) | |
print("Calibrated humidity: " + str(humidityCalibrated)) | |
#print(data) | |
except Exception as e: | |
print("Fehler") | |
print(e) | |
# Initialisation ------- | |
def connect(): | |
p = btle.Peripheral(adress) | |
val=b'\x01\x00' | |
p.writeCharacteristic(0x0038,val,True) | |
#print(val.hex()) | |
p.withDelegate(MyDelegate("abc")) | |
return p | |
# Main loop -------- | |
# Main loop -------- | |
parser=argparse.ArgumentParser() | |
parser.add_argument("--device","-d", help="Set the device MAC-Adress in format AA:BB:CC:DD:EE:FF") | |
parser.add_argument("--battery","-b", help="Read bat:terylevel every x update", metavar='N', type=int) | |
parser.add_argument("--round","-r", help="Round temperature to one decimal place",action='store_true') | |
# parentgroup=parser.add_argument_group("Calibration") | |
# parentgroup.add_mutually_exclusive_group() | |
#calgroup = parser.add_mutually_exclusive_group() | |
offsetgroup = parser.add_argument_group("Offset calibration mode") | |
offsetgroup.add_argument("--offset","-o", help="Enter an offset to the humidity value read",type=int) | |
# calgroup.add_argument_group(offsetgroup) | |
# parentgroup.add_argument_group(offsetgroup) | |
complexCalibrationGroup=parser.add_argument_group("2 Point Calibration") | |
complexCalibrationGroup.add_argument("--TwoPointCalibration","-2p", help="Use complex calibration mode. All arguments below are required",action='store_true') | |
complexCalibrationGroup.add_argument("--calpoint1","-p1", help="Enter the first calibration point",type=int) | |
complexCalibrationGroup.add_argument("--offset1","-o1", help="Enter the offset for the first calibration point",type=int) | |
complexCalibrationGroup.add_argument("--calpoint2","-p2", help="Enter the second calibration point",type=int) | |
complexCalibrationGroup.add_argument("--offset2","-o2", help="Enter the offset for the second calibration point",type=int) | |
# | |
# calgroup.add_argument_group(complexCalibrationGroup) | |
# parentgroup.add_argument_group(complexCalibrationGroup) | |
args=parser.parse_args() | |
if args.device: | |
if re.match("[0-9a-fA-F]{2}([:]?)[0-9a-fA-F]{2}(\\1[0-9a-fA-F]{2}){4}$",args.device): | |
adress=args.device | |
else: | |
print("Please specify device MAC-Adress in format AA:BB:CC:DD:EE:FF") | |
os._exit(1) | |
else: | |
parser.print_help() | |
# print("Please specify device address") | |
os._exit(1) | |
if args.TwoPointCalibration: | |
if(not(args.calpoint1 and args.offset1 and args.calpoint2 and args.offset2)): | |
print("In 2 Point calibration you have to enter 4 points") | |
os._exit(1) | |
elif(args.offset): | |
print("Offset calibration and 2 Point calibration can't be used together") | |
os._exit(1) | |
p=btle.Peripheral() | |
cnt=0 | |
while True: | |
try: | |
if p.waitForNotifications(2000): | |
# handleNotification() was called | |
if args.battery: | |
#every = int(args.battery) | |
if(cnt % args.battery == 0): | |
batt=p.readCharacteristic(0x001b) | |
batt=int.from_bytes(batt,byteorder="little") | |
print("Battery-Level: " + str(batt)) | |
res = requests.get("http://"+veraip+":"+str(port)+"/data_request?id=variableset&DeviceNum="+str(temperaturedeviceid)+"&serviceId=urn:micasaverde-com:serviceId:HaDevice1&Variable=BatteryLevel&Value="+str(batt)) | |
res = requests.get("http://"+veraip+":"+str(port)+"/data_request?id=variableset&DeviceNum="+str(humiditydeviceid)+"&serviceId=urn:micasaverde-com:serviceId:HaDevice1&Variable=BatteryLevel&Value="+str(batt)) | |
cnt += 1 | |
print("") | |
continue | |
except: | |
print("Trying to connect to " + adress) | |
p=connect() | |
print ("Waiting...") | |
# Perhaps do something else here |

[Unit] | |
Description=LYWSD03MMC2VERA | |
After=multi-user.target | |
[Service] | |
Type=simple | |
ExecStart=/usr/bin/python3 /home/pi/scripts/LYWSD03MMC.py -d A4:C1:38:7F:E6:DC -r -b 100 | |
Restart=on-abort | |
[Install] | |
WantedBy=multi-user.target |
